UW-L Competes at UW-River Falls Invite

Minneapolis, Minn. - The UW-La Crosse women's swimming & diving team completed action at the UW-River Falls Invitational Saturday night at the University of Minnesota. The competition was split into two divisions. In the Red Division, the Eagles finished fifth with 224.0 team points while in the White Division, UW-L was sixth overall with 226.0 points.

In action in the UW-River Falls White Division, Chelsea Hoff won the 50 freestyle (23.92) while placing third in the 100 freestyle (52.40) and 100 backstroke (59.77).

Danielle Ellingson finished fourth in the 400 I.M. (4:48.01) and 16th in the 200 breaststroke (2:40.79) while Dayna Johnson placed eighth in the 400 I.M. (4:58.21) and 11th in the 200 butterfly (2:18.96).

The Eagles' Jennifer Bryson was 11th in the 400 I.M. (5:00.67) and Katelyn Hartung 13th in the 100 freestyle (54.24).

UW-L had four relays place in the top-five this weekend. The 400 freestyle relay of Hartung, Ellingson, Kasey Madden and Abby Diehl was fourth overall (3:37.93). The Eagles' 200 freestyle relay of Hoff, Brianna Peyer, Madden and Hartung were fifth (1:40.11). The 200 and 400 medley relays also finished fifth. The 200 medley relay of Hoff, Peyer, Madden and Hartung went 1:50.43 while the 400 medley relay of Hoff, Peyer, Ellingson and Diehl finished with a time of 4:04.20.

In the Red Division, Taylor Smith finished second in the 100 butterfly (1:00.42) and 12th in the 200 butterfly (2:23.93). UW-L's Carissa Paasch placed sixth in the 200 breaststroke (2:35.92) and seventh in the 100 breaststroke (1:12.42) while Shannon Carlin finished eighth in the 100 breaststroke (1:12.96) and 10th in the 200 breaststroke (2:37.93).

Hannah Mueller was eighth in the 50 freestyle (25.55) while Brittany Erb finished 11th (2:38.24) and Emily Schweitz 16th (2:42.68) in the 200 breaststroke.

In the 1,650 freestyle, Rachel Howard was 13th (19:24.35), Anna Kaye 21st (20:05.31) and Mariah Schisler 26th (20:34.20).

Colleen Tierney was 14th in the 200 backstroke (2:21.83) and Sarah Kisiolek 15th in the 400 I.M. (5:03.50).

UW-L had three relays in the top-eight in the Red Division. The 200 medley relay of Howard, Erb, Smith and Mueller were fifth (1:55.23); the 400 freestyle relay of Howard, Lauren Kaiser, Mueller and Laura Reifenberg finished seventh (3:45.66) and the 400 medley relay of Tierney, Carlin, Smith and Mueller placed eighth (4:17.96).

UW-L returns to action Saturday, Dec. 12 at UW-Eau Claire at 1 p.m.

Did You Know...
UW-L's student-athletes recorded a cumulative grade point average of 3.210 in 2010-11, the highest in the WIAC.  The Eagles also had the highest number of student-athletes, 376, posting grade point averages above 3.000.
